About Aspose.Words MCP Server

Connect your Aspose.Words Cloud account to any AI agent and take full control of your professional document lifecycle and content manipulation workflows through natural conversation.

Cline operates autonomously inside VS Code. it reads your codebase, plans a strategy, and executes multi-step tasks including Aspose.Words tool calls without waiting for prompts between steps. Connect 10 tools through Vinkius and Cline can fetch data, generate code, and commit changes in a single autonomous run.

What you can do

  • Multimodal Document Conversion — Programmatically convert base64-encoded files across 40+ formats (DOCX, PDF, HTML, Markdown, etc.) with high-fidelity formatting preservation
  • Content Orchestration — Perform advanced search-and-replace, insert watermarks, and accept all tracked changes to coordinate document revisions in real-time
  • Document Intelligence — Extract high-fidelity statistics including word counts and page metrics, or render specific pages into image formats (PNG, JPEG) for instant previews
  • Security & Protection — Programmatically apply password protection or restrict editing to maintain high-fidelity document integrity and compliance
  • Storage Architecture — Manage your directory of cloud-hosted files and oversee document lifecycle from upload to deletion directly through your agent

Aspose.Words + Cline FAQ

Common questions about integrating Aspose.Words MCP Server with Cline.

01

How does Cline connect to MCP servers?

Cline reads MCP server configurations from its settings panel in VS Code. Add the server URL and Cline discovers all available tools on initialization.
02

Can Cline run MCP tools without approval?

By default, Cline asks for confirmation before executing tool calls. You can configure auto-approval rules for trusted servers in the settings.
03

Does Cline support multiple MCP servers at once?

Yes. Configure as many servers as needed. Cline can use tools from different servers within the same autonomous task execution.
